Shreeya
A feminine name of Sanskrit origin meaning "beautiful" or "prosperity".
For 2026, the newest official UK baby-name figures on this page are from 2023. That release is the current official benchmark rather than a forecast.
Shreeya is a girl's name in the UK records. People looking for Shreeya popularity in 2026 should use the latest official release, which is 2023 in this profile. In that release it ranked #4056, with 5 babies registered with the name. Its strongest year in the published records was 2014, with 19 births.
This profile covers 234 England and Wales registrations across 25 recorded years from 1996 to 2023. The figures come from ONS England and Wales, so the page is a view of published baby-name registrations rather than a forecast or a live count of people using the name today.
The latest count is about 26% of the recorded peak, which gives a quick read on how the name has moved since its high point.
We estimate that about 233 living people in the UK are called Shreeya. This uses published birth registrations from England and Wales, Scotland and Northern Ireland, then applies ONS national life tables to estimate how many are likely still alive. It does not forecast extra births for 2024 or 2026.

What does Shreeya mean?
The name Shreeya finds its origins in the Sanskrit language, which is an ancient Indo-Aryan language that dates back to the 2nd millennium BCE. It is derived from the Sanskrit word "Shri," which means glory, prosperity, or radiance. Shreeya is a feminine name that is commonly used in India, particularly among Hindus.
In Hindu mythology, the name Shreeya is associated with the goddess Lakshmi, who is the embodiment of wealth, fortune, and prosperity. The name is believed to bring good luck and fortune to the bearer, making it a popular choice for parents in India.
One of the earliest recorded examples of the name Shreeya can be found in the ancient Hindu scriptures, such as the Vedas and the Upanishads. However, it is difficult to pinpoint the exact origin or first use of the name due to the vast history and diversity of Indian culture.

Shreeya by decade
Decade totals smooth out the yearly jumps and make it easier to see whether Shreeya was a short-lived spike or a name that stayed in regular use. Average rank is calculated only from years where a published rank exists.
| Decade | Average rank | Total births | Years covered |
|---|---|---|---|
| 2020s | #3450 | 13 | 2 |
| 2010s | #2988 | 99 | 10 |
| 2000s | #2113 | 97 | 9 |
| 1990s | #2453 | 25 | 4 |
